During the federal COVID-19 Public Health Emergency (PHE), most OHP members were able to keep their OHP regardless of changes. Beginning April 1, 2023, we will start reviewing the eligibility of all OHP members. We call this “Renewing Your OHP.” To keep your OHP, please respond to us if we ask you for more information. Not

Medicare becomes your primary coverage, but you also keep your OHP until you renew. When you renew your OHP: You may qualify for another two years of OHP, or; You may no longer qualify for OHP. In that case, you may qualify for a Medicare Savings Program. Learn more about Medicare Savings Programs .

Yamhill …Scenario 2: If determined ineligible for full OHP, the veteran will be screened for the new dental program. If determined eligible for the dental program, coverage will begin on January 1, 2023. The veteran will need to submit discharge documentation to keep ongoing dental coverage. 4. $31,200. $62,400. OHP Bridge is for people who are more likely to be uninsured or fall in and out of health coverage due to income changes. OHP Bridge will help them maintain coverage and access to care. OHP Bridge will eventually cover about 100,000 people. An estimated 55,000 people who currently have OHP Plus will move to OHP Bridge when ...

You manage your health care with providers who take FFS OHP. Providers who take FFS OHP agree to bill OHA (not a CCO) for your care. Your OHP coverage letter will come two or three weeks after your Notice of Eligibility. The letter lists your coordinated care organization (CCO). If you still have questions or concerns, call the Provider Services Unit at 1-800-336-6016. .The Oregon Health Plan (OHP) is Oregon’s Medicaid and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P) plan. You can get OHP if you meet income and other requirements. People of all ages and any immigration status can qualify. OHP provides free health coverage. For the most current information about a financial pro...Continuous OHP enrollment and acceptance of self-attested financial eligibility criteria ended 3/30/2023 (OHA). The state resumed the following activities 4/1/2023: ... Extended fair hearing timelines for OHP benefit and eligibility decisions: Fair hearing timelines returned to the original 90-day timeline, and are no longer 120 days. Oregon is resuming eligibility... hwy i 80 road conditions OHP Bridge – Basic Health program is a new health insurance program that expands OHP to cover adults with income just above the OHP income limit. Adults with income between 138 and 200 percent of the federal poverty level (FPL) will have access to quality health coverage through OHP Bridge, provided by the same coordinated care organizations ... October 17, 2023. Oregon Health Authority (OHA) has finalized the 2024 capitation rates for coordinated care organizations (CCOs). These rates are the per-member-per-month amounts the state pays CCOs to coordinate health care for Oregonians who are members of the Oregon Health Plan (OHP).
